Why a 4 Flat Trailer Connector Is Necessary

I’ve found that a 4 flat trailer connector is one of the simplest and most important parts of towing safely. It gives me the basic lighting connection between my vehicle and trailer, so my trailer’s tail lights, brake lights, and turn signals work properly. Without it, other drivers may not see my intentions clearly, which can make towing unsafe and stressful.

I also like that the 4 flat connector makes hooking up a trailer quick and easy. It is a standard connection for many small trailers, so I do not have to deal with complicated wiring every time I tow. That convenience saves me time and helps me get on the road with confidence.

For me, it is necessary because it helps keep everything legal and road-ready. When my trailer lights work correctly, I reduce the risk of tickets, accidents, and wiring problems. In short, the 4 flat trailer connector gives me safety, simplicity, and peace of mind every time I tow.

My Buying Guides on 4 Flat Trailer Connector

What I Look for in a 4 Flat Trailer Connector

When I shop for a 4 flat trailer connector, I first make sure it matches my vehicle and trailer setup. I want a connector that gives me reliable lighting for the basic trailer functions: turn signals, brake lights, and tail lights. I also pay attention to the wire quality, weather resistance, and how easy it is to install.

Why I Prefer a 4 Flat Connector

From my experience, a 4 flat trailer connector is the simplest and most practical option for many small trailers, utility trailers, boat trailers, and lightweight towing needs. I like that it is easy to use, widely compatible, and usually more affordable than larger connector types.

Compatibility Matters

Before I buy, I always check whether my vehicle already has a factory towing plug or if I need an adapter or wiring kit. I also confirm that the trailer uses the standard 4-way flat configuration. If the connector does not match, I know I may run into lighting problems right away.

Build Quality and Durability

I look for connectors made with strong insulation and corrosion-resistant materials. Since trailer wiring is often exposed to rain, dirt, and road debris, I want something that can handle harsh conditions. In my experience, a well-built connector lasts much longer and causes fewer electrical issues.

Ease of Installation

I prefer a connector that is straightforward to install, especially if I plan to do it myself. Some options come with plug-and-play features, while others may require cutting and splicing wires. I usually choose the one that saves me time and reduces the chance of wiring mistakes.

Weather Protection

I always appreciate a connector that includes a dust cover or protective cap. This helps keep moisture and debris out of the terminals. In my experience, this small feature can make a big difference in keeping trailer lights working properly.

Wire Length and Flexibility

I check the wire length to make sure it reaches comfortably from my vehicle’s wiring point to the connector mount. I also want the wire to be flexible enough to route neatly without strain. A connector with the right length makes installation much cleaner and safer.

Testing and Reliability

After installation, I always test the connector to make sure all lights function correctly. I look for steady performance, no flickering, and secure connections. A reliable 4 flat trailer connector gives me confidence every time I tow.
